Frequent question: Does style tag have to be in head?

According to the current spec, yes, style elements must always be in the head . There are no exceptions (except a style element inside a template element, if you want to count that).

Does the style tag need to be in the head?

The <style> element must be included inside the <head> of the document. In general, it is better to put your styles in external stylesheets and apply them using <link> elements.

Can I put style tag inside body?

…then there is literally no harm * in placing <style> tags within the body, as long as you future proof them with a scoped attribute. The only problem is that current browsers won’t actually limit the scope of the stylesheet – they’ll apply it to the whole document.

Which tags must be located in the head section?

The <head> tag in HTML is used to define the head portion of the document which contains information related to the document. The <head> tag contains other head elements such as <title>, <meta>, <link>, <style> <link> etc. In HTML 4.01 the <head> element was mandatory but in HTML5, the <head> element can be omitted.

THIS IS INTERESTING:  How do you apply inline style?

Is head tag mandatory in HTML?

head is required and it should be used just once. It should start immediately after the opening html tag and end directly before the opening body tag.

Is style in head or body?

style is supposed to be included only on the head of the document. Besides the validation point, one caveat that might interest you when using style on the body is the flash of unstyled content.

Is style a tag?

The <style> tag is used to define style information (CSS) for a document. Inside the <style> element you specify how HTML elements should render in a browser.

Where can I use style tag?

Used within <head> or <body>, HTML style tags define internal styling for elements. This styling information contains CSS. It might apply to the whole document or a part of it. HTML inline styles override externally included CSS, but can be overridden by the style attribute.

What CSS selector would style a tag that looks like this?

Descendant selector

The descendant selector is how you can apply styles to all elements that are descendants of a specified element. Selecting all <h1> elements nested inside <div> elements looks like this.

What does style mean in HTML?

Styles in HTML are basically rules that describe how a document will be presented in a browser. Style information can be either attached as a separate document or embedded in the HTML document.

What is the use of title tag?

The title tag is an HTML code tag that allows you to give a web page a title. This title can be found in the browser title bar, as well as in the search engine results pages (SERP). It’s crucial to add and optimise your website’s title tags, as they play an essential role in terms of organic ranking (SEO).

THIS IS INTERESTING:  How can you change the size and style of the text in an HTML file viewed on a Web browser?

What is the purpose of head tag?

The <head> element is a container for metadata (data about data) and is placed between the <html> tag and the <body> tag. Metadata is data about the HTML document. Metadata is not displayed. Metadata typically define the document title, character set, styles, scripts, and other meta information.

What does head tag mean in HTML?

The head of an HTML document is the part that is not displayed in the web browser when the page is loaded.

What is an A in HTML?

The <a> HTML element (or anchor element), with its href attribute, creates a hyperlink to web pages, files, email addresses, locations in the same page, or anything else a URL can address. Content within each <a> should indicate the link’s destination.

Website creation and design